Highland Park Hill
Highland Park Hill is a hill in County of Camrose No. 22, Alberta and has an elevation of 810 metres. Highland Park Hill is situated nearby to the hamlet New Norway, as well as near the village Ferintosh.| Tap on a place to explore it |

New Norway
Hamlet
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
New Norway is a hamlet located in central Alberta, Canada within Camrose County. Named in 1895, it is located on Highway 21, approximately 100 km southeast of Edmonton and 22 km southwest of Camrose. New Norway is situated 6 km northeast of Highland Park Hill.
